It had been almost a year since she had seen him last. It had been the longest 12 months of her life. She turned 23 years old this year and Giles had told her that she was gaining on the longest living slayer. She had one more year left and then she would match the oldest living slayer. She was now the same age as Nikki Wood was when she died.

She was amazed every time she thought about when she was called. It had been nine years since she had been called to be the slayer, and nine years of fighting demons, and now she was pretty much able to retire. She had more reasons now in her life than ever to get her to set aside her calling, and to help Giles rebuild the Watcher’s Council. Buffy was Giles’ right hand woman now, as Giles was now head of the Watcher’s Council.

Xander and Andrew were being trained as watchers in London too. Giles believed Xander and Andrew both had it in them to make excellent watchers. Xander especially because of all the things that Xander had done in the 6 and a half years that Buffy had been in Sunnydale. Xander was one of the easier ones to train. Andrew would be easy too only if he grew up a little more.

Willow was living in London with them too, but she went back and forth between London and the coven in Bath. She was also with the help of the coven training some of the potentials that also had signatures to be Wicca. Willow wanted to make sure that none of these girls were overwhelmed by their powers and have a psychotic melt down. The Scoobies all understood this from experience. Giles and Buffy agreed with Willow and the coven that this methodology would be the best course of action to take with these girls.

Buffy was proud of what these girls were becoming. A lot of the potentials had come a long way from what they had been. Faith and Robin were living in Cleveland protecting the hellmouth there. Robin was Faith and Kennedy's watcher as well as a principal at one of the high schools in Cleveland. Kennedy ended up there because Kennedy got so jealous of the time Willow spent training other potentials that Willow broke up with her, so she moved to be with Robin and Faith.

Dawn was enrolled in a school in London, and she was almost finished, she was being trained as a potential, a watcher and even had a signature to be a Wicca. Buffy thought that maybe all this had to do with her being the key, but then realized that it probably came with being special to the Guardian Slayer. She had just turned 18 years old and was with a vampire who fought the good fight. His name was Liam Kincade, and he reminded Buffy that there was a whole lot more to life, and that she needed to live for the now. He was kind to Dawn and he loved her, and he was instantly taken in by the Scoobies.

They had met Liam in Greece, Buffy and Giles had traveled there to bring a potential back to London with them. Buffy and Giles had gone out one night to take a walk and they stumbled across a vampire staking his own kind, the next night he killed a snake demon, and when he looked up from his kill, he saw Buffy and Giles staring at him. He walked up to Buffy and kissed her hand and said " It is a honor to be serving the Powers that Be with someone as great as you."

They brought him back to London with them also. Liam was always amazed that he got to serve in the presence of the Guardian Slayer, and that led him and Buffy to have a very close bond, but not like what she knew she’d had with Spike.


Buffy remembered the night before the big fight that closed the hell mouth and the passion that her and Spike shared. It was different than anything that they had gone through before and they were so gentle and affectionate with each other. Buffy had believed that Spike was going to make it through and he had told he believed that he was too. Buffy later thought that he knew he wasn’t going to make it through the fight that night, but only told her as they were lying there only to ease her mind. After the fight in the hell mouth, Buffy shed so many tears for her lost love; she was upset that he had denied their love, even after they had claimed each other the night before.

None of the other Scoobies knew that Spike and Buffy had mated but Liam did, Buffy told him not to tell the others. Liam had once admired the necklace Buffy always wore and when he got a good look at the symbol, Liam was amazed that her mate was a member of the clan of Aurelius, the master’s line, the most revered clan of vampires in the vampire world.

When they spent three weeks in LA with Angel she was surprised that he hadn’t picked up the fact that she and Spike had mated. He did try to tell her that she didn’t need to spend her tears over Spike and that he wasn’t worth it. Angel was surprised that Buffy was wearing a necklace that Spike had given her. It was the one he’d had made out of thick pure silver before Angel had been cursed. Spike never parted with that necklace, it was the symbol of the order of Aurelius, the clan that they belonged to. Angel finally gave up trying to get her to forget Spike, he knew that something had happened between them and Buffy refused to tell Angel what it was.

Buffy and Giles had moved to London shortly after their stay in LA. She was given a big surprise a few months after. It was one of the best surprises of her life, too bad her mother was not around to be here with her.


Buffy was brought out of her thoughts by her brother in law Liam. “Buffy, my sweet sister, the plane is about ready to take off. Let us go now Rupert is waiting for us.” Liam said in his beautiful Irish Brogue that reminded her of Angel every now and then. Liam lifted a pair of carriers and looked down at the precious cargo inside, and smiled at Buffy. Buffy looked down at the precious cargo in the carriers and said “We are about to go and see grandpa!” Buffy walked out toward the private jet that the Watcher's Council had in its possession.

Buffy was about to make her way back to California, and back to LA and her former lover Angel. She had butterflies the size of bats flying in her stomach. She was nervous about seeing him again. She no longer loved him the way she used to, but he had a different place in her heart now. Spike had taken his place in her heart and he was gone for good now, but she would carry on with out him for the sake of one of them had 'to go on living'. She smiled as she remembered his singing that phrase to her two years ago. Buffy decided while she looked down at her precious cargo she could do this, she had to do it, if not for her then for them.
